Actor Dinker Sharma to play cricketer Kirti Azad in Ranveer Singh starrer 83 – read exclusive details

The film about India’s glorious victory at the 1983 world cup will be directed by Kabir Khan

The preparation for Ranveer Singh’s 83 is in full force and CineBlitz has been giving you exclusive updates about the same. The new entry to the ensemble is actor Dinker Sharma who will be playing the ace cricket Kirti Azad in the 1983 World Cup biopic. And here are all the exclusive details you need to know. While we exclusively informed some time ago you that Gully Boy fame Vijay Varma was roped in to play Roger Binny in the Kabir Khan directorial. Today the team gets another addition to make the super Team 11 with Dinker Sharma’s name being added.

The actor will be playing the character of cricketer Kirti Azad who was also a part of the iconic team that bought the 1983 world cup home. Kirti Azad is known to be an aggressive batsman and an off-spinner. Azad is now a member of the Lok Sabha. Whereas Dinker is known for his roles in Delhi Crimes a film that released recently starring Shefali Shah in lead role, Diker also did another film called the Cat People. The actor has been working in off-beat and small projects, but this seems to be his first big break and we will have to wait to see what this new talent has to offer. Team 11 is almost complete and we will reveal a few other names to you soon. While we do that don’t forget to catch the real team on Kapil Sharma’s show tomorrow night, you never know if they might give you some interesting anecdotes that you can look forward to in 83.

83 is a biopic based on the 1983 World Cup victory that the team India made possible and brought the cup home. The film stars Ranveer Singh as Kapil Dev – the then Captain of the team, Pankaj Tripathi, Saqib Saleem, Jatin Sarna and a few more in pivotal roles. Earlier Kabir Khan was also spotted in London on a recce tour of the Lord’s Cricket Ground where the finals were played. Wouldn’t it be exciting to see the film showcase the finals on the same pitch? Ranveer has already begun his share of preparation as the biggest challenge for him will be cracking Kapil Dev’s iconic bowling style.
